  • Title

    Influence of ionising radiation on intelligent electronic implantable devices

  • Abstract
    This article is about influence of ionising radiation on intelligent implantable cadrioverter and its parts. The importance of such an analysis reflects the fact that people with implanted pacemakers are not recommended for radiotherapy because of a presumed risk of damage to the pacemaker.
